Суббота, 2024-04-27, 2:26 AM
 
English  Русский  Начало Каталог статей Регистрация Вход
Вы вошли как "Гость" · RSS
Google
Меню сайта
Форма входа
Наш опрос
Какой из разделов сайта вызывает у Вас наибольший интерес

Результаты · Архив опросов

Всего ответов: 255
Каталог статей
» Статьи » Решение проблем с Data-кабелем

Доработка Data-кабеля USB-to-Serial
Часть 1
Доработка Data-кабеля (аналога DCA510 USB-to-Serial) у которого в разъем, подключаемый к телефону, приходят провода к контактам 2(GND), 3(TXD), 4(RXD) (так называемый трехпроводный кабель, вариант доработки полного кабеля, в котором провода выведены к контактам 2,3,4,5,6,7 рассмотрим ниже во 2 части статьи). В некоторых вариантах таких кабелей задействован контакт 1(Vbat) разъема, используемый для зарядки телефона. Так как наличие или отсутствие зарядки на работу кабеля не оказывает влияния, кроме случая прошивки телефона (в этом случае зарядку телефона необходимо отключать), то далее в схемах проводник к этому контакту разъема рассматриваться не будет. Рассмотрим доработку трехпроводного кабеля на примере кабеля, собранного на микросхеме PL2303 (фото 1, фото 2), так как это один из наиболее распространенных вариантов Data-кабеля (кабели, собранные на других микросхемах дорабатываются аналогичным образом).

Фото 1

Фото 2

Для полноценной работы кабеля в разъеме должны быть задействованы следующие контакты: 2(GND), 3(TXD), 4(RXD), 5(CTS), 6(RTS), 7(DCD). Проводники к первым трем контактам (2(GND), 3(TXD), 4(RXD)) уже выведены, нам остается только вывести проводники к контактам 5(CTS), 6(RTS) и 7(DCD). В большинстве Data-кабелей используется плата, на которой реализована полноценная схема и нам остается взять в руки мультиметр или тестер (подойдет любой прибор, умеющий измерять сопротивление) и найти на плате контакты, к которым выведены необходимые нам сигналы от микросхемы PL2303, для этого воспользуемся схемой полноценного кабеля.
Схему можно взять здесь

Выводы на этой плате промаркированы, воспользуемся этим для более наглядного представления результатов наших поисков и внесем в эту таблицу уже известные нам данные (табл. 1)
сигналразъем телефонавывод платы ножка PL2303
Vbat* 1 1 -
GND 2 10 -
TXD 3 3 5
RXD 4 6 1
CTS 5 - 11
RTS 6 - 3
DCD 7 - 10

Табл. 1

* - для кабелей с возможностью подзарядки

Теперь тестером/мультиметром (в режиме измерения сопротивления) находим на какие контакты платы выходят проводники от ножек 3, 10, 11 микросхемы PL2303 и вносим данные в таблицу (табл. 2).
сигналразъем телефонавывод платы ножка PL2303
Vbat* 1 1 -
GND 2 10 -
TXD 3 3 5
RXD 4 6 1
CTS 5 9 11
RTS 6 5 3
DCD 7 4 10

Табл. 2


* - для кабелей с возможностью подзарядки

Теперь осталось только соединить проводами необходимые контакты разъема с соответствующими контактами платы. В существующем отрезке кабеля обычно проводников для этого не хватает, оптимальным выходом является замена его на отрезок кабеля с достаточным кол-вом проводников (лучше всего для этого подходит отрезок кабеля UTP-5 “витая пара”, там 8 проводов и этого хватает с запасом). Далее переходим ко 2-й части

Часть 2

Доработка Data-кабеля (аналога DCA510 USB-to-Serial) у которого в разъем, подключаемый к телефону, приходят провода к контактам 2(GND), 3(TXD), 4(RXD), 5(CTS), 6(RTS), 7(DCD) и определяемого телефонами Siemens x65-x75 (набираем на клавиатуре телефона *#06#, выбираем «Др. функции», смотрим строку «Acc:») как «plugged in»

Рис. 1

Обычно для того чтобы заставить такой кабель нормально работать достаточно впаять два резистора по 10 ком между контактами 2(GND)-5(CTS) и 2(GND)-7(DCD) (рис. 2) . После этого телефон опознает кабель как «plugged in DCA510» и должен работать без проблем.


Рис. 2

Иногда подключение к компьютеру кабеля с телефоном вызывает отключение последнего. Основной причиной является завышенное напряжение (выше +3,6V) на контакте 4(RXD) разъема кабеля. Проверяется причина отключения измерением напряжение на контакте 4(RXD).


Рис. 3


Решением данной проблемы служит снижение напряжения на этом контакте. Для этого можно использовать обычный делитель напряжения

Рис . 4


Стабилитрон с токоограничивающим резистором

Рис. 5


Или эмиттерный повторитель на любом маломощном n-p-n транзисторе


Рис. 6

Последний вариант оказывает на работу схемы наименьшее влияние, но эффективен только при напряжениях на контакте 4(RXD) не превышающем +4,2V, т. к. эмиттерный повторитель снижает напряжение только на 0,6V. Иногда снижения напряжения на контакте 4(RXD) разъема кабеля бывает недостаточно. Тогда придется использовать методы приведенные на рисунках №№ 4, 5, 6 еще и для снижения напряжения на контакте 6(RTS) разъема кабеля (схемы для этого варианта можно посмотреть здесь), хотя данный случай встречается редко (в основном на контакте 6(RTS)присутствует уровень логического «0»)

©siemensdca.ucoz.ru
Категория: Решение проблем с Data-кабелем | Добавил: SiemensDCA (2007-03-27)
Просмотров: 10801 | Рейтинг: 0.0

Категории каталога
Решение проблем с Data-кабелем [7]
Делаем Data-кабель [1]
Раздел посвящен самостоятельному изготовлению Data-кабелей
Разное [2]
Всевозможные схемы, не входящие в другие разделы
Поиск по каталогу
Друзья сайта
Поиск электронных компонентов по складам поставщиков России и СНГ.
Статистика

Rambler's Top100